On Tue, Sep 26, 2023 at 4:44 PM Lingadahally, Vishakha (2023) <vishakha.lingadahally.2...@live.rhul.ac.uk> wrote: > > Dear GCC Team, > > I'm running Ubuntu 22 on my Mac virtually and my gfortran version is 11.4.0. > When I try to install a certain software package, I encounter the following > error: > > gfortran: error: unrecognized argument in option '-mcmodel=medium' > gfortran: note: valid arguments to '-mcmodel=' are: large small tiny > > Is this due to attempting to run gfortran on arm64 architecture? Could you > please let me know how I could resolve the issue?
You have to turn to Ubuntu here, -mcmodel=medium is certainly supported in GCC 11, maybe Ubuntu patches out the support? > > Thank you > > Warm regards, > Vishakha > > This email, its contents and any attachments are intended solely for the > addressee and may contain confidential information.
